A problem with your outboard lower unit can be truly frustrating, leaving you stranded on shore and itching to get back on the water. Luckily, understanding some basic troubleshooting and following these steps can help you resolve common lower unit issues yourself, saving you time and money in the process.
First, thoroughly examine your lower unit for any signs of wear. Check the seals, gaskets and o-rings for cracks or leaks, look for stripped threads, and make sure all fasteners are properly fastened.
If you discover any malfunctions, you can often replace them with readily available parts from your local marine supply store. Remember, safety is paramount. Always disconnect the battery before working on your outboard and foll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ully.

Superior Outboard Lower Unit Care & Restoration
Proper care of your outboard lower unit is crucial for smooth operation and longevity. A well-maintained lower unit will ensure reliable performance, extend its lifespan, and prevent costly repairs down the road. Frequently inspecting and servicing your lower unit can help identify potential problems before they become major issues.
Here are some key elements to consider when it comes to outboard lower unit upkeep:
- Examine the condition of the engine's transmission for any signs of corrosion.
- Lubricate all moving components according to your manufacturer's guidelines.
- Keep the drive shaft clean and free of any sediment that could cause damage.
- Rinse the water passage regularly to prevent buildup.
If you notice any problems with your outboard lower unit, it's important to seek professional assistance. A qualified mechanic can identify the problem and provide the necessary fixes. Don't delay seeking assistance if you experience any unusual vibrations or function issues with your outboard.
